64.2-508. Personal representative must send notice of the probate. An affidavit of that notice must be filed with the Clerk within 4 months. Not required if personal representative is the proponent is the sole heir and beneficiary or estate is less than $5000.

Tips to Remove Fillable Fields Legal Virginia Probate Forms For Free

  1. Open the legal Virginia probate form in a PDF editor that allows editing.
  2. Look for options to convert the fillable PDF to a non-fillable format, usually found in the 'File' menu.
  3. Use the 'Edit' tool to select the fillable fields and delete them.
  4. Save the edited document as a new file to ensure you keep a copy of the original.
  5. If the PDF editor has a 'Flatten' option, use it to remove all interactive elements from the form.

You may need to remove fillable fields from Virginia probate forms when preparing a paper copy for submission or when you want to create a static version of the document for records.

Where can I find court approved forms? The Virginia Judicial System has a number of forms for each court available on the court's form page. When printing the completed form, use the "Print for Submission to Court" button at the top of the form and field highlighting will be removed.
